The Family Advocacy Program provides intensive home visiting services for parents who are seeking out parenting support, active with DCFS and/or have children who are identified as at risk for or foster care. Family Advocates are professional parent educators who teach basic living and parenting skills in the home setting in addition to connecting families to various community resources and supports.

The Incredible Years® is a proven, research-based program for parents of children ages 1–8. Through weekly group sessions, parents learn positive discipline, communication skills, and ways to manage challenging behaviors.

What You’ll Learn:

  • Encouraging positive behavior
  • Setting clear limits
  • Reducing stress and conflict
  • Strengthening parent-child bonds

A four-week infant care class for pregnant women, partners, and families.  Case management and counseling is offered to all birth parents and their families.  Following the birth of the baby, new parents meet with the case manager in the home setting and can receive individual counseling as requested.

Healthy Start is a community-based program that supports expecting parents and families with young children, ensuring every child has the best possible beginning.

We offer free, in-home, personalized support including prenatal education, parenting resources, health screenings, and connections to local services. Our goal is to promote healthy pregnancies, strengthen families, and help children grow and thrive.
